Cha Taehyun had once played the role of the male lead, Zhang Jifeng, in the TV series Juliet's Boyfriend. The drama was broadcasted in Korea in 2000 and was directed by Guo Zairong. It starred Cha Taehyun, Yi Zhiyuan, and Chi Jinhee. The plot told the story of Zhang Jifeng meeting Cailin on a flight and starting a love story.

Chen Xiaoyun was a singer who sang Hokkien songs. He sang a song called " Love is just right." The song was included in the album Hokkien Classics 135, which was released on March 15, 1992. " Coincidentally Love " was a Pop song. The lyrics described a bustling night and charming music, expressing the desire and yearning for love. This song could be downloaded and listened to online on Netease Cloud Music. In addition, Chen Xiaoyun also performed other Hokkien songs, such as "The Liar of Love, I Ask You" and "Lover Leaves With Someone".
